AI outsourcing

The Future of AI Outsourcing: Emerging Technologies to Watch

The Future of AI Outsourcing: Emerging Technologies to Watch

Artificial Intelligence (AI) has become a game-changer in the business world, revolutionizing the way companies operate and driving innovation across industries. As AI technology continues to advance, more and more businesses are turning to outsourcing to access the expertise and resources needed to develop and deploy cutting-edge AI solutions. In this article, we will explore the future of AI outsourcing and the emerging technologies that businesses should watch out for.

Emerging Technologies in AI Outsourcing

1. Natural Language Processing (NLP)

Natural Language Processing (NLP) is a subset of AI that focuses on the interaction between computers and human language. NLP technology enables machines to understand, interpret, and generate human language, making it possible for businesses to automate tasks such as customer service, sentiment analysis, and content generation. NLP is a rapidly evolving field with the potential to transform how businesses interact with their customers and employees.

2. Computer Vision

Computer Vision is a branch of AI that enables machines to interpret and analyze visual information. This technology is used in a wide range of applications, from facial recognition and autonomous vehicles to medical imaging and industrial quality control. With the development of advanced algorithms and deep learning techniques, computer vision is becoming more accurate and efficient, opening up new opportunities for businesses to leverage visual data in their operations.

3. Reinforcement Learning

Reinforcement Learning is a type of machine learning that enables agents to learn how to make decisions by interacting with their environment and receiving feedback on their actions. This technology is particularly well-suited for tasks that require trial-and-error learning, such as game playing, robotics, and optimization problems. Reinforcement Learning is still in its early stages, but it has the potential to revolutionize how businesses automate complex decision-making processes.

4. Generative Adversarial Networks (GANs)

Generative Adversarial Networks (GANs) are a type of neural network architecture that consists of two networks – a generator and a discriminator – that are trained to compete against each other. GANs are used to generate realistic synthetic data, such as images, audio, and text, that can be used for various applications, including data augmentation, content creation, and fraud detection. GANs have the potential to revolutionize how businesses generate and analyze data, enabling them to uncover hidden patterns and insights that were previously impossible to detect.

5. Edge Computing

Edge Computing is a distributed computing paradigm that brings computation and data storage closer to the source of data generation, such as IoT devices, sensors, and mobile devices. By processing data locally at the edge of the network, businesses can reduce latency, improve scalability, and enhance security. Edge Computing is especially important for AI applications that require real-time processing, such as autonomous vehicles, predictive maintenance, and smart cities.

FAQs

1. What are the benefits of outsourcing AI development?

Outsourcing AI development offers several benefits, including access to specialized expertise, cost savings, faster time-to-market, and scalability. By partnering with a reputable AI outsourcing provider, businesses can leverage the latest technologies and best practices to develop and deploy AI solutions that meet their specific needs and objectives.

2. How can businesses ensure the security and confidentiality of their data when outsourcing AI development?

To ensure the security and confidentiality of their data when outsourcing AI development, businesses should carefully vet potential outsourcing partners, implement robust data encryption and access control measures, and establish clear data protection policies and procedures. It is also important to regularly monitor and audit the outsourcing process to detect and prevent any security breaches or data leaks.

3. What are the challenges of outsourcing AI development?

One of the main challenges of outsourcing AI development is the lack of control over the development process and the quality of the final product. Businesses may also face communication barriers, cultural differences, and intellectual property issues when working with offshore outsourcing providers. To address these challenges, businesses should clearly define their requirements, establish effective communication channels, and conduct regular reviews and evaluations of the outsourcing project.

4. What are the emerging trends in AI outsourcing?

Some of the emerging trends in AI outsourcing include the rise of AI-as-a-Service (AIaaS) platforms, the adoption of AI automation tools, the integration of AI with other emerging technologies, such as blockchain and Internet of Things (IoT), and the growing demand for ethical AI development practices. As AI technology continues to evolve, businesses can expect to see new opportunities and challenges in the outsourcing landscape.

In conclusion, the future of AI outsourcing is bright, with emerging technologies such as Natural Language Processing, Computer Vision, Reinforcement Learning, Generative Adversarial Networks, and Edge Computing driving innovation and transformation across industries. By staying abreast of these trends and leveraging the expertise of reputable outsourcing providers, businesses can unlock the full potential of AI technology and gain a competitive edge in the market.

Leave a Comment

Your email address will not be published. Required fields are marked *